Essential Features of Boots for Motorcycle Riding

When selecting boots for motorcycle riding, several defining features significantly contribute to both comfort and safety. Durable materials such as leather or synthetic textiles enhance protection against abrasions and weather elements. Reinforced toe caps and ankle support are also critical, safeguarding against potential injuries during rides.

A non-slip sole is another vital characteristic of quality riding boots, providing essential traction. This feature minimizes the risk of slipping when mounting or dismounting the motorcycle. Additionally, waterproofing ensures that your feet remain dry in inclement weather, making for a more enjoyable riding experience.

Comfort is equally important; thus, choosing boots with adequate cushioning and ventilation makes a marked difference, especially on long journeys. Many boots also incorporate adjustable fit systems, allowing for personalized comfort and security while riding.

Lastly, reflective materials in the design can enhance visibility, crucial for safety during low-light conditions. These essential features collectively ensure that boots for motorcycle riding not only protect but also enhance the overall riding experience.

Waterproof Boots

Waterproof boots are specifically designed to prevent water from penetrating the interior, ensuring the rider’s feet remain dry in adverse weather conditions. This feature is particularly beneficial for motorcyclists who frequently ride in rainy climates or face unexpected downpours.

These boots often incorporate materials such as Gore-Tex or proprietary waterproof membranes that effectively block moisture while still allowing breathability. This balance enhances comfort by preventing overheating and excessive sweating during extended rides.

In addition to waterproofing, many models of boots for motorcycle riding provide reinforced protection in crucial areas, such as the toe, heel, and ankle. This added durability not only resists wear and tear but also offers the necessary protection in the event of an accident.

When selecting waterproof boots, riders should consider factors such as fit, insulation, and traction. A well-chosen pair can significantly enhance the overall riding experience, making them an indispensable accessory for any serious motorcycle enthusiast.

Maintenance Tips for Boots for Motorcycle Riding

To maintain the longevity and performance of boots for motorcycle riding, it is important to follow specific care routines. Regular cleaning and conditioning can significantly enhance the boots’ durability and functionality.

Cleaning the boots after each ride removes dirt and debris that can lead to wear. Use a soft brush or cloth to gently wipe down the exterior. For deeper cleaning, consider using a designated leather or textile cleaner compatible with your boot material.

Conditioning is particularly important for leather boots, as it helps to maintain flexibility and prevents cracking. Apply a quality leather conditioner every few months, especially if the boots are regularly exposed to harsh conditions. Ensure the conditioner is fully absorbed before wearing the boots again.

Proper storage is also essential. Store boots in a cool, dry place, away from direct sunlight or heat sources. Using a boot tree or stuffing them with newspaper can help maintain their shape and prevent creasing.

Measuring Your Foot Size

To accurately measure your foot size for the selection of boots for motorcycle riding, begin by gathering necessary tools: a tape measure or ruler and a piece of paper. Placing the paper on a flat surface, stand with your heel against a wall to ensure proper alignment.

Next, mark the longest point of your foot on the paper. It is advisable to measure both feet, as one foot may be slightly larger than the other. After marking, use the tape measure or ruler to determine the distance from the edge of the paper to the mark.

Comparing this measurement against a shoe size chart will help in identifying your ideal boot size. Bear in mind that different brands may have varying sizing standards, so check the specific brand’s size guide when selecting boots for motorcycle riding. This meticulous approach is essential to ensure comfort and safety while on the road.
